The Taste of Hays set to return in Jan.

Posted Dec 25, 2021 11:30 AM

Kansas Big Brothers Big Sisters serving Ellis County recently announced they are excited to bring The Taste of Hays back to the community.

"Join us on Sunday, Jan. 16, starting at 4:00 p.m. at the Fort Hays State University Memorial Union Ballroom," the announcement said.  "Enjoy samplings of culinary creations from local restaurants and vendors at Taste of Hays."

Proceeds from the event support Kansas Big Brothers Big Sisters in Ellis County. 

A total of 250 tickets are available for the event.

"Tickets are $100 each, which admits 2 people," the announcement said. "Your ticket also enters you into multiple prize drawings that will be given away throughout the event."

Tickets can be purchased at thier website, 4kidsake.org/tasteofhays, or at their offices at 1200 Main St, Suite 102.

Sponsoring restaurants and vendors include, Big Smoke BBQ, Bricks Rockin' BBQ, Cathy's Breads, Fuzzy's Taco Shop, G Herdt’s Donuts, Gigi's Cafe, Hickok's Steakhouse, JD's Country Style Chicken, Macarons & More by Mitch, Old Chicago, Parties by Design, Professor's, Rose Garden Banquet Hall, Taco Shop, The Garden Grille & Bar - The Hilton Garden Inn, The Golden Q, The Local Food Truck, The Press and Thirsty's Brew Pub & Grill.

"Kansas Big Brothers Big Sisters’ mission is to create and support one-to-one mentoring relationships that ignite the power and promise of youth," the organization said. "KSBBBS in Ellis County currently serves 150 Big and Little matches.  Your support of this event, positively impacts these important match relationships and helps screen new volunteers for the children waiting for their Big Brother or Big Sister."
